ZANESVILLE, Ohio – Planners at Ohio University Zanesville are focusing on a summit planned later in September. The Future of Work & Education Summit will feature discussions about the future of work, automation and internationalization.

“Right now we’ve got five generations that are in the workforce together and you know, businesses are seeing this as a struggle. Higher education is seeing it as a struggle with the needs we have to prepare the students as they enter the workforce. It’s a great opportunity to get experts from our area in to listen to what’s happening,” says Holly Voltz, Marketing & Public Relations Specialist at Ohio University Zanesville.

“Students are coming out — the texting is so prevalent. That’s how they talk. When we do our mock interviews, that’s not uncommon for students to come in and it’s very hard for them to carry on a conversation because of the way they’ve been communicating is a little bit different when you go into a workforce. So those soft skills are important,” Voltz added.

The featured speaker will be Dr. David Delong, an expert who helps leaders implement practical solutions to address critical skill shortage created by major changes in workforce demographics, shifts in generational values and new technologies.
